Core Insights - The core message highlights the significant impact of the "trade-in" policy on consumer goods sales in China, with a total sales amount exceeding 2.5 trillion yuan and benefiting over 360 million people [1] Group 1: Sales Impact - The trade-in program for consumer goods has driven sales exceeding 2.5 trillion yuan from January to November this year [1] - The automotive sector saw over 11.2 million vehicles traded in, while home appliances accounted for over 12.844 million units [1] - Digital products, including mobile phones, received subsidies for over 9.015 million units, and electric bicycles saw over 1.291 million units traded in [1] Group 2: Policy Support - The Chinese government has allocated 300 billion yuan in special long-term bonds to support the trade-in program across four batches this year [1] - The acceleration of policy effects is fostering the development of new consumption patterns, particularly in digital and green sectors [1] Group 3: Industry Transformation - The trade-in initiative is promoting the green transformation of related industries, indicating a shift towards more sustainable consumption practices [1]
